Details About the Aldi Staff Only Shop

The Aldi Staff Only Shop, which recently opened in several locations across the UK, allows employees to purchase items at discounted rates. The concept is designed to provide regular Aldi employees with a more affordable way to shop, particularly for essential groceries and household items. The store’s layout features a curated selection of Aldi’s most popular products, ensuring that staff can easily find what they need.

This initiative is not merely about discounts. It represents Aldi’s commitment to fostering a positive work environment and addressing employee welfare as central to its business philosophy. By implementing this shop, Aldi aims to boost morale among its staff by giving them a tangible benefit that enhances their employment experience.
